ART Stop.jpgJanice Taylor, Beliefnet blogger, reporting in from Omega Institute of Holistic Studies in The Catskills, New York.

Our Lady of Weight Loss and I are leading a workshop entitled "Our Lady of Weight Loss EnLIGHTens." (She always gets top billing!) There are about twenty fabulous people in Our Lady's group.

Yesterday's afternoon session centered around taking a good long and honest look at our self-limiting beliefs and excuses. In other words, we explored our very brilliant "Stay Fat Strategies."

Think about it. If you have been 'trying' to lose weight, permanently remove the excess and have not succeeded, then you've implemented your very own 'stay fat strategy,' haven't you? And it stands to reason that if you have figured out how to stay fat or stuck, then you are capable of turning your strategy around, doesn't it?

As you know, it is Our Lady of Weight Loss's mission to make weight loss fun. So we are most definitely having lots of laughs as we learn about ourselves and 'let go' of our excuses, 'let go' of what's holding us back.

Here are some of the fun strategies from us at Omega to you (wherever you might be)!

Top Ten Strategies on How to Stay Fat!

1. Blame someone else; our mother, husband, kids ... anyone else!

2. Wear stretchy clothes.

3. Never partake in activities that make you sweat.

4. Go grocery shopping when hungry, and be sure to bust open a bag of chips before you hit the check-out line (yes, do pay for them).

5. Declare Friday greasy pizza day.

6. Delude thyself ... often.

7. Believe that food tastes better at midnight.

8. Eat out A LOT.

9. Drink alcohol when eating out.

10. Chocolate always and forever!
